Devil's Trumpet is the first in the Gardening Mystery series. It is set in the Hood River area of Oregon, and the main character, Rachel O'Connor, is a young landscaper with her own business.
Rachel is landscaping the old Columbia River Inn, which the owner, Henry, hopes to repair and open. When Henry falls from a dangerous bridge between the main grounds and a stone gazebo, the death is looked into by the police. Rachel's employee, Julio, is one of the suspects. He is a young immigrant with limited English skills, and Rachel feels she needs to protect him.
I enjoyed the book, and the descriptions of the area. The characters were interesting, and the story moved along fairly well. I have 2 other books in the series I'm reading soon.
